Chapter 243
Zhong Ning stood on the rooftop of the main city, bored out of her mind, watching a crowd of players taking screenshots of her phoenix.
Two minutes later, a newcomer who had just joined the guild was somewhat nervously invited into the party. Zhong Ning had her latch onto her character, then plunged into the dungeon and began slaughtering everything in sight.
Inside the game, the boss wore a white robe, seated upon the moon, a flute held in his hand. The drifting melody of the flute transformed into streaks of icy blades. Zhong Ning dodged with practiced ease, yet her thoughts suddenly wandered far away.
Just now, Xie Shiqing had also been dressed in a white dress, her calves exposed. When she fell into the bushes, the skirt had likewise been torn open by the branches. A patch on her lower leg had already turned blue from the impact, making her appear especially fragile, like a crystal that had fallen to the ground and cracked.
She lost focus for a moment. Her character was killed, a mechanic misplayed, causing a full party wipe. After everyone revived, Zhong Ning pressed her lips together and, in a few swift moves, brought the boss down.
She said to the newcomer, ‘Pick a white hairstyle you like. I’ll gift it to you.’
After saying that, she logged off and sent a large red packet in the group chat.
Xie Shiqing was moving out.
With the villa mortgaged, she had gone completely bankrupt. After settling all the remaining payments, the money across all her bank cards did not even amount to twenty thousand yuan.
Zhong Ning bought the residence.
Both families had lived on the mountaintop. She had quite liked this neighbor who rarely went out, as it made the place feel as though she were the only one there.
Since it was now vacant, there was no need to let anyone else move in.
She did not think Xie Shiqing would agree to her ‘proposal’. It had been spoken on a whim. When she woke the next day, she realized it was indeed rather insulting, though she did not feel any particular regret or guilt.
She had always done as she pleased, never caring about others’ opinions.
